Sometimes staying becomes impossible

Every dispute regarding employment commences with an official termination letter. In some cases employees are obliged to resign due to the terms of work have drastically changed.

Unacceptable working conditions might be created by the employer, such as decreasing compensation, shifting employees without their consent or altering an employees’ responsibilities. These situations may raise questions involving constructive dismissal Ontario.

Because cases of constructive dismissal depend on factual circumstances, it is essential to consult a legal professional before you sign off. An experienced employment lawyer can look over the circumstances and help explain whether the employer’s actions may have fundamentally altered the relationship between employees.

Everyone deserves a safe workplace.

When employees feel respected and valued, they’ll perform to their fullest. However, many workplaces fall short of these standards.

Workplace harassment concerns Toronto remain a problem for professionals from a variety of industries. Harassment can be characterized by repeated harassment or bullying, discrimination, retaliation, inappropriate comments, or any other behaviour that can create an atmosphere of workplace violence. Unresolved issues can affect the psychological well-being of employees and their career.
